BenQ DC C800 introduction : BenQ will unveil a new addition to its digital camera line up, the BenQ DC C500 digital camera. The BenQ DC C800 features a 8 Megapixel CCD image sensor and a 3x optical zoom lens. The BenQ C800 digital camera has a sleek, compact design, versatile in functions, and is an ideal option for consumers seeking high quality multi-function digital camera at a reasonable price range. “BenQ once again steps onto the global stage by providing consumers with digital cameras that possess high quality lens, a large comfortable display, and enriched features in a compact, stylish design,” said Peter Chen, BenQ Vice-President and Digital Media Business Group General Manager.

BenQ C800 camera - 8 Megapixels
The compact BenQ DC C800 features a high resolution 8 Megapixels CCD image sensor, 3X optical zoom, MPEG-4 movie format and a large 2.4-inch TFT LCD screen for clear and comfortable photo viewing. The DC C800 digital camera is equipped with Printer Mode for direct printing via compatible printer and Burst Mode, which allows 4 shots to be taken per snap. The BenQ DC C800 digital camera can be used as a dictaphone and is bundled with 32 MB built-in memory. The BenQ DC C800 will be launched in November 2005.
About BenQ
The BenQ Group is currently comprised of ten companies that operate independently while sharing resources and leveraging synergies among them. The BenQ Group companies include AU Optronics Corporation, the world’s third largest manufacturer of LCD panels; Darfon Electronics Corporation; Daxon Technology Inc; Airoha Technology Corporation; Copax Photonics Corporation; Darly Venture Inc; BenQ Guru Software Co., Ltd; Philips BenQ Digital Storage; and Cando Corporation. 2004 revenues for BenQ Group exceeded US$10.8 billion dollars.
